LIFE CYCLE title: life cycle (IS-R) (SAP Library - Glossary)
LIFE CYCLE category: Retail (IS-R)
LIFE CYCLE explained:
Period consisting of the typical life phases (e.g. product launch, market penetration, market saturation) of a product.
The life cycle defines the total period over which a product is managed.
